CRIMINAL LIBEL.

(PER PRESS ASSOCIATION.) Auckland, January 22. The proprietors of the Auckland weekly newspapers, the Observer and Free Lance

(Messrs T.. L. Kelly and H. J. Baulf) were committed for trial at the Police Court today, before Dr Giles, R. M., for alleged criminal libel on Thomas Mace Humphrej r s, a local solicitor. The libel consisted in certain paragraphs in the paper alleged to refer to Humphrey’s private character.
